跳转到主要内容

运输标签的基本模块

项目描述

Beta License: AGPL-3 OCA/delivery-carrier Translate me on Weblate Try me on Runboat

此模块添加了一些功能和通用内容,以帮助生成运输标签。例如,它添加了根据拣选或类别不同而可能不同的运输商选项的概念,以存储运输商账户。此模块本身不执行任何操作,它作为其他特定于运输商的模块的基本模块。

目录

用法

**它如何工作?**

在拣选UI中,一个“发送给承运人”按钮触发标签生成,调用models/stock.picking.py中的send_to_shipper()。

**如何实现我自己的承运人?**

定义一个由_send_shipping原生方法调用的方法{carrier}_send_shipping()。使其返回以下形式的列表字典

{
    "exact_price": price,
    "tracking_number": 'number'
    "labels": [{
        "package_id": package_id,
        "name": filename,
        "datas": file_content (base64),
        "file_type": extension,
        "tracking_number": package_number
    }]
}

问题跟踪器

问题在GitHub问题上跟踪。如果在那里遇到麻烦,请检查您的问题是否已经被报告。如果您是第一个发现它的人,请通过提供详细且受欢迎的反馈来帮助我们解决问题。

不要直接联系贡献者以获取支持或帮助解决技术问题。

致谢

作者

  • Camptocamp

  • Akretion

贡献者

维护者

本模块由OCA维护。

Odoo Community Association

OCA,即Odoo社区协会,是一个非营利组织,其使命是支持Odoo功能的协作开发并推广其广泛应用。

本模块是GitHub上OCA/delivery-carrier项目的组成部分。

欢迎您贡献力量。有关详情,请访问https://odoo-community.org/page/Contribute

项目详情


下载文件

下载适合您平台的应用程序。如果您不确定选择哪个,请了解更多关于安装包的信息。

源代码分发

本发布版本没有提供源代码分发文件。请参阅生成分发存档的教程

构建分发

由以下支持

AWS AWS 云计算和安全赞助商 Datadog Datadog 监控 Fastly Fastly CDN Google Google 下载分析 Microsoft Microsoft PSF 赞助商 Pingdom Pingdom 监控 Sentry Sentry 错误记录 StatusPage StatusPage 状态页面